Job Title: Clinical Audiologist – Part time

Location: Manchester

Salary: Competitive base salary with uncapped commission

About the Company

Audiological Science Ltd is a leading provider of audiology services, committed to enhancing the quality of life for our patients. We provide expert care across both private and NHS sectors, offering professional, patient-centred solutions using the latest hearing technologies.

About the Role

We are seeking a skilled and motivated Clinical Audiologist to join our growing team. This is a part-time, patient-facing role, involving home visits and in-clinic appointments across multiple locations. The position requires flexibility to travel between 2 to 3 clinics within the designated area.

We welcome applications from students and early-career professionals who are eager to gain hands-on experience in a dynamic and supportive environment. If you are passionate about hearing health and enjoy working closely with patients, we encourage you to apply.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ct hearing assessments and consultations for both NHS and private patients
  • Recommend, fit, and fine-tune hearing aids to meet individual patient needs
  • Provide thorough aftercare and follow-up support to ensure optimal patient outcomes
  • Maintain accurate and compliant patient records
  • Manage stock of hearing aids and associated equipment

Qualifications

  • Qualified Audiologist with relevant experience
  • HCPC registration (Health and Care Professions Council)
  • Full UK driving license
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
  • Strong commitment to delivering high-quality, patient-focused care
